RDX-CMDB推进剂激光点火特性

DOI: 10.3969/j.issn.1006-9941.2011.03.008

Keywords: 物理化学,双基推进剂,激光点火,热流密度,点火延迟时间

Full-Text   Cite this paper   Add to My Lib

Abstract:

采用CO2激光点火的方法研究了双基推进剂SQ-2和RDX-CMDB推进剂在不同热流密度作用下的点火特性,探讨了RDX含量、Al粉和燃烧催化剂对RDX-CMDB推进剂点火性能的影响。实验结果表明,SQ-2和RDX-CMDB推进剂(含Al粉的配方除外)的点火延迟时间随热流密度增加而递减,且热流密度较高时,点火延迟时间变化趋缓。RDX-CMDB推进剂中RDX含量、Al粉和催化剂对其点火延迟时间的影响与热流密度大小有关。在较低热流密度(51.5W·cm-2)时,除Al粉使推进剂的点火延迟时间变长以外,其他组分对点火延迟时间的影响则不大;在较高热流密度(102W·cm-2和153W·cm-2)时,试样的点火延迟时间随着RDX含量的增加而变长,Al粉和催化剂的加入对点火过程和点火延迟时间均有较大影响。
